President Bola Ahmed Tinubu departed Yokohama, Japan, on Thursday night for an ultra-long-haul flight to Brazil, where he will begin a state visit on August 24.

The President will make a stopover in Los Angeles, United States, before continuing his journey to Brasilia, the Brazilian capital.

Tinubu had embarked on the two-nation trip on August 15, departing Abuja with his delegation. The team made a brief stop in Dubai, United Arab Emirates, before arriving in Yokohama on the morning of August 18.
While in Japan, the President attended the opening ceremony and plenary of the ninth Tokyo International Conference on African Development (TICAD9) on August 20.

He also held a series of bilateral meetings with world leaders and wrapped up his engagements with an interactive session with Nigerians in the diaspora on Thursday night.
